Product Overview
The Fusion Apollo Marine Zone Amplifier is designed to expand audio zones and enhance sound quality on your vessel. It is specifically engineered for compatibility with Fusion DSP-enabled stereos (Apollo RA770, Apollo RA670, Apollo WB670, and RA210) and Fusion speakers. Key features include:
- Easy Tune Feature: Automatically adjusts audio settings for optimal sound quality. This feature requires setup using the Fusion-Link app on a compatible smartphone.
- Class-D Amplifier Design: Utilizes less power, contributing to longer listening periods and reduced battery drain.
- Voltage Compatibility: Operates with both 12-volt and 24-volt electrical systems.
- Mounting: Includes a mounting bracket for straightforward installation.
Important Note: This amplifier is exclusively designed for use with Fusion DSP-enabled stereos and Fusion speakers.

Installation
Mounting the Amplifier
- Select a suitable mounting location that is dry, well-ventilated, and provides easy access for wiring. Ensure the location is protected from direct exposure to water, although the unit is True-Marine™ designed.
- Position the mounting bracket at the chosen location.
- Mark the screw holes through the mounting bracket onto the mounting surface.
- Drill pilot holes if necessary, appropriate for the 6-gauge self-tapping screws.
- Secure the mounting bracket using the three provided 6-gauge self-tapping screws.
- Slide the Apollo zone amplifier onto the secured mounting bracket until it clicks into place.

Maintenance
General Care
- Regularly inspect all wiring and connections for signs of wear, corrosion, or damage.
- Keep the amplifier clean and free from dust and debris. Use a soft, dry cloth for cleaning. Av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ners.
- Ensure adequate ventilation around the amplifier to prevent overheating.
Water Resistance
The amplifier is designed with IPX7 water resistance, meaning it can withstand incidental exposure to water. However, it is not intended for prolonged submersion. Always ensure all covers and connections are properly sealed.
Troubleshooting
No Audio Output
- Verify that the amplifier is receiving power and its indicator light is on.
- Check all audio connections between the amplifier, stereo, and speakers.
- Ensure the connected Fusion DSP-enabled stereo is powered on and configured correctly for the amplifier.
- Confirm that the volume levels on both the stereo and any connected devices are not muted or set too low.
Distorted Sound
- Check for loose or corroded speaker wire connections.
- Ensure the input signal from the stereo is not overdriven. Adjust the stereo's output level if necessary.
- Verify that the Easy Tune feature is properly configured via the Fusion-Link app.
Amplifier Overheating
- Ensure the amplifier has adequate ventilation and is not installed in an enclosed space without airflow.
- Reduce the volume or check for speaker impedance issues that might be causing the amplifier to work harder than intended.
